Tôlanaro in Summer
In summer (December, January and February), Tôlanaro sees average daytime highs around 27°C and overnight lows near 23°C, with 487 mm of rain over about 47 wet days across the season. It is the warmest season of the year and the wettest season of the year.
Across summer, daytime highs hold fairly steady around 27°C.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 28% of the time across summer, and the air most often feels oppressive.
Summer is Tôlanaro's weakest season of the year to visit on our travel score. For the whole year in context, see Tôlanaro's year-round climate.

Temperature in Tôlanaro in Summer
Across summer, daytime highs hold fairly steady around 27°C.
A typical summer day in Tôlanaro reaches about 27°C and drops to 23°C overnight. The warmest of the three months is January, the coolest December.

Hazard calendar for Tôlanaro
In summer, Tôlanaro overlaps its cyclone and rainy season season. The full year is below, with each hazard's peak months called out.
Tôlanaro sits in the South Indian Ocean cyclone belt; the season peaks January–March.
Tôlanaro's rainy season runs November–April, when most of the year's rain falls.

Sea temperature near Tôlanaro in Summer
The nearest coast averages about 26°C across summer — the other half of the beach question. The full-year curve and swim-comfort zones are below.
The sea at the nearest coast (about 15 km away) is warmest in February at about 26°C and coldest in August near 22°C.
The water stays above 20°C all year — warm enough for a swim any month.

UV index in Tôlanaro in Summer
Clear-sky midday UV across summer averages around 14 (very high — sun protection essential). The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.
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Tôlanaro peaks around January 20 at about 14 (extreme)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near June 20 at about 5 (high).
The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— every month of the year.

Where is Tôlanaro?
Tôlanaro sits at 25.0°S, 47.0°E, 27 m above sea level, in Madagascar. The nearest listed city is Amboasary, 60 km away.
Topography around Tôlanaro
How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Tôlanaro.
Within 3 km, the terrain around Tôlanaro has signific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 432 m around an average of 21 m above sea level; within 16 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 795 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,959 m.
The land around Tôlanaro is covered by water (53%) within 3 km, water (56%) within 16 km, and water (42%), grassland (22%) and trees (20%) within 80 km.
